Output c340131337c3a61fc63bc774a0fecba63de23acda41109863d70a96fa8c7967f:1

value
7420496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bfe58a1a75dacf62fbc42ee2b4101077b26fe9c OP_EQUAL
address
MEpyc6tna6b6ekYGkeYvexHaqFvxhtq1YX
transaction
c340131337c3a61fc63bc774a0fecba63de23acda41109863d70a96fa8c7967f
spent
true